Sausage Cream Cheese Crescents: An Incredible Ultimate Recipe

Ingredients

– 1 can crescent roll dough
– 1 pound of breakfast sausage (cooked and crumbled)
– 8 oz cream cheese (softened)
– 1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or your choice)
– 1 teaspoon garlic powder (optional)
– 1 teaspoon onion powder (optional)
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Cooking spray or parchment paper (for baking)

Instructions

Creating these delightful Sausage Cream Cheese Crescents is an enjoyable experience, especially when you follow these simple steps:

1.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per or spray with cooking spray.
2. Cook Sausage: In a skillet, cook the breakfast sausage over medium heat until browned and crumbled, about 5–7 minutes. Drain excess fat if necessary.
3. Mix Filling: In a mixing bowl, combine the cooked sausage, softened cream cheese, shredded cheese,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per. Mix until smooth and well combined.
4. Prepare Crescent Dough: Unroll the crescent roll dough on a clean surface. Separate the dough into triangles along the perforated lines.
5. Fill the Dough: Place a generous spoonful of the sausage and cream cheese mixture at the wide end of each triangle.
6. Roll: Carefully roll up the crescent starting from the wide end towards the point, pinching the edges to seal the filling inside.
7. Arrange on Baking Sheet: Place the rolled crescents on the prepared baking sheet, ensuring they’re spaced apart.
8. Bake: Bake in the preheated oven for 15–20 minutes or until golden brown and flaky.
9. Serve Warm: Once baked, let them cool slightly before serving. Enjoy while warm!
